Students are exempted from taking CSU’s English and mathematics placement exams if they present proof of one of the following:

 

English Proficiency

·        A score of 550 or above on the verbal section of the SAT I

·        A score of 680 or above on the SAT II: Writing Test

·        A score of 24 or above on the ACT English Test

·        A score of 3, 4, or 5 on either the Language & Composition or Literature & Composition examination of the Advanced Placement Program

·        Completion and transfer to the CSU of a college course that satisfies the requirement in English Composition, with a grade of C or better

 

Mathematics Proficiency

·        A score of 550 or above on the mathematics section of the SAT I

·        A score of 550 or above on Level IC or IIC of the SAT II: Mathematics Test

·        A score of 23 or above on the ACT Mathematics Test

·        A score of 3, 4, or 5 on the Advanced Placement Calculus AB or Calculus BC examination  

·        A score of 3, 4, or 5 on the Advanced Placement Statistics examination

·        Completion and transfer to the CSU of a college course that satisfies the requirement in Quantitative Reasoning, with a grade of C or better
